We are looking for a Senior Vice President of Search to join our leadership team. Company Search powers findability and discovery across all of the Company products. The diversity and scale of the data is unprecedented -- over 300B records, with 7B updates a day spanning relational data, unstructured content and social graph data. As data volumes are growing and customers are expecting more intelligence in their products, never has search been more important.
As SVP of Engineering for Search, you will own our strategy and execution to deliver an enterprise cloud search platform and intelligent search products on that platform. The executive leading this area will manage, grow, and inspire a world-class, global team of technologists and managers, developing new technology to establish search as a market differentiator in Company products, enable efficient and productive navigation for our users and be a driver for our business. Partnership with GMs, CTOs and UX across product lines, along with customer and industry facing engagement, are key to achieving this.
